The Breakfast Club Discussed Boosie, Badazz being brought to tears as slain rapper Trouble was laid to rest. The fellow musicians were very close said, Angela Yee.

“I didn’t get to tell my boy, thank you. So, I want to tell Trouble thank you.

He always supported me, and I’m hurting for y’all because I’m hurting for five years…,” said Boosie. Angela Yee said that trouble was a male co-host on the Lip Service show. He wanted to do an episode of Lip Service in Atlanta and bring Boosie on board.

“He was just a really cool person.

He was cool with all of us, so rest in peace to Trouble,” said Yee. When he was killed, the woman who was with Trouble took her social media page down; she said it took a lot for her to put her page back up.

“It took a lot for me to put my page back up. I don’t like the evil things that’s being said about me or the negative narratives and the threats, and I don’t have nothing to prove to social media.

To the ones that know me personally, know my heart is gold, and my story will be told. This situation has mentally messed me up and traumatized me,” she said.
